Engraving
Engraving is a printing technique in which an image is transferred from a matrix to a support such as paper or fabric. Dies can be made from metal, wood, stone or other materials, and are engraved with specific tools to create the desired image. Once engraved, the matrix is inked and pressed against the support, transferring the image. Engraving allows the production of multiple copies of the same image, each with unique details and textures from the original matrix. This technique is widely used in the production of artwork, illustrations and large-scale prints.
